5 Tips for Freshening Up Your House

It’s an inevitable reality that we accumulate things we don’t need and can grow tired of looking at the same four walls every day.

You’ve heard of the magic of spring cleaning, but sometimes a freshen up is needed whatever the season.

Here are five tips for transforming your house at any time of the year.

1. Have a Big Clear Out

Go from room to room with a big bin bag, and chuck in whatever is no longer serving you. You’ll be surprised at what comes out of drawers and cupboards that you’d forgotten you had!

Some charities such as the British Heart Foundation offer services such as free postage and free collection for donations, meaning that your belongings can get a second chance at life from someone else, at no extra cost to you!

3. Check on the Integrity of Your Home

While you’re clearing out your home, it’s worth checking for any damage and creating an inventory of what needs fixing or refreshing.

Whether it’s a bit of paint that needs patching up, or a scuffed skirting board, fixing all the damage at the same time will help you feel like you’re getting a clean slate.

You may want to re-paint in a different colour, or completely remove and replace something with a new idea.

4. Move Your Furniture Around

Sometimes just moving your furniture into new positions around the room can help you feel like you have a brand-new home.

You may be able to re-configure your layout to incorporate more space into a previously cramped room, or even introduce some furniture into a different room to re-purpose it.

For example, you could take a spare bedroom and move a desk and bookshelves from other rooms to create a study.

5. Don’t Discount the Garden

Outdoor space is great for maintaining good mental health, so if you have a garden, it’s beneficial to invest some time into making it suit your needs, whatever your preferences are.

Even if you don’t have a green thumb, maintaining your garden can be about putting out some potted plants, painting your fence or buying a garden bench for a particularly sunny spot.
